How can indian hotels prepare for the coming summer season with hospitality tech?

More and more people in India are travelling, and they’re choosing to do it closer to home.

A recent report found that 82% of Indians wanted to travel last summer, and 92% of them planned to visit domestic destinations.

For hotels, this is an amazing opportunity to get more guests, make more money, and build a rock-solid reputation as a pioneering hotel at the start of a tourism boom. But many hotels could also get left behind and fail to make the most of this trend.

To succeed here, you need to make use of technology. Hotels now have access to some truly remarkable tools and software solutions to attract, retain, and delight their guests.

 

In this article, we’ll look at a few ways Indian hotels can set themselves up for success this coming summer.

USE A GREAT BOOKING ENGINE

Booking engines are fantastic tools for hotels. They help you reduce your reliance on third-party platforms like Booking.com and Yatra, and get more direct bookings instead of paying commission costs for every guest. The best booking engines (like ours at Hotel-Spider) make the booking process as smooth, painless, and rewarding as possible for your guests. They’re clear, simple, informative, and include value-added perks like free breakfast, early check-in, and organized activities. In Hotel-Spider, you can also create packages specific to the summer season, like weekend excursions and family-oriented stays.

USE A CHANNEL MANAGER TO IMPROVE ONLINE DISTRIBUTION

A channel manager helps you build a strong online presence and keep your rates the same across all the channels you use, like OTAs, metasearch engines, and your own website.

With the right channel manager, you can avoid overbookings and make sure you get as many eyes as possible on your rooms during the busiest periods of the year. Summer 2025 is shaping up to be huge for the Indian domestic tourism market, and a great channel manager can help you take maximum advantage of all that opportunity.

TRANSFORM YOUR GUESTS’ EXPERIENCE WITH CUTTING-EDGE TOOLS

The trend is clear: guests want more automation. A recent survey found that more than 40% of travellers prefer to check in via a hotel’s website or app, and almost 80% of them would be willing to stay at a hotel with a fully automated or self-service front desk.

Tap into the wealth of automated messaging tools and chatbots to confirm confirmations, offer upsells like airport transfers and room upgrades, and give local recommendations for a better trip. Post-stay feedback forms and questionnaires can also be highly useful tools to learn more about your guests, improve their experience, and improve your reputation and Google and OTAs.
